* %d int * %f float\double * %ld long * %lld long long * %c char * %s 字符串 * %zd unsigned long * * 清空指针: * int a = 10; * int *p = &a; * //1、 * // p = 0; * //2、注意不是null * //p = NULL; * 清空指针后指针将不能再访问指向的区域 * ***/inta =10...
1%p输出指针里面存储的地址值2不能乱用类型,比如int a =10;float*p = &a; 6、指针清空 1p =0;2p = NULL; 二、指针的注意事项 1//代码举例2//不建议的写法, int *p只能指向int类型的数据3int*p;4doubled =10.0;5p = &d;67//指针变量只能存储地址8int*p;9p =200;101112//指针变量未经过初始化,...
方法1:使用运行库函数memset():memset(str, 0, sizeof(str));方法2:使用Windows API函数ZeroMemory():ZeroMemory(str, sizeof(str));但不能用于指针。指针的情况下,必须这样:struct mystr *p;...memset(p, 0, sizeof(struct mystr));或:ZeroMemory(p, sizeof(struct mystr));...
C语言如何清空栈,我们现在赶紧来看看,C语言如何清空栈。
3、使用指针操作 我们还可以使用指针操作的方式来清空字符数组的元素,具体操作如下: #include <stdio.h> #include <string.h> void clear_array(char arr[], int size) { char *ptr = arr; while (*ptr != '
链表是由一连串节点组成的数据结构,每个节点包含一个数据值和一个指向下一个节点的指针。链表可以在头部...
以下是详细的步骤和代码示例来清空一个C语言文件: 1、包含必要的头文件 为了操作文件,你需要包含标准输入输出头文件stdio.h。 2、使用文件指针 在C语言中,文件通过文件指针进行操作,需要定义一个FILE类型的指针变量。 3、使用fopen函数打开文件 使用fopen函数以写入模式("w")打开文件,如果文件成功打开,fopen会返回一...
10.2 文件指针 10.3 打开文件fopen 10.4 关闭文件fclose 10.5 一次读写一个字符 10.6 一次读写一个字符串 10.7 读文件fread 10.8 写文件fwrite 10.9 随机读写 文章记录了学习C语言程序设计基础入门全过程,包含详细讲解和代码实现过程。 第1章 环境搭建 1.1 Visual Studio软件安装、注册 1.2 在Visual Studio创建工程...
C语言程序执行效率很高,可以直接操作内存。 C语言学习目标 掌握C语言的语法规则,数组、循环、函数、指针等。 要学会一些算法,比如冒泡排序、快速排序、递归等。 26.3K42 扫码 添加站长 进交流群 领取专属10元无门槛券 手把手带您无忧上云 相关资讯 C语言编程实例:一键清空目标文件夹 ...
memset(buffer, '*', strlen(buffer) );// //数组直接首地址传进去。 主要是对数组指针的修改!!因为可以被修改而const char int等这些不能被修改 和malloc 配套使用 printf("Buffer after memset: %s /n", buffer); return 0; } 1. 2. 3. ...